What is the most stable country in Europe?
Political stability index (-2.5 weak; 2.5 strong), 2022:

Countries Political stability, 2022 Global rank
Liechtenstein 1.64 1
Andorra 1.59 2
Iceland 1.26 3
Monaco 1.2 4

What is the safety rank in Czechia : 12th

While it dropped a few spots compared to last year, the country remains significantly safer than its neighbors. A new index by Numbeo surveyed 43 European nations, placing the Czech Republic at 12th for safety. This is a slight decrease from its 10th-place ranking in 2023.

Of the world's top 20 safest countries, 14 are in Europe. And 29 European countries are in the world's top 50. Almost all countries in Europe are safer for students than the United States of America. Europe is generally considered the safest region in the world.

Switzerland has the highest overall life satisfaction in 2022. With a mean country score of 8.0, Switzerland had the highest self-reported overall life satisfaction in 2022 (out of countries with available data), followed by Austria and Finland (both at 7.9).

Is Czech language hard to learn

The Foreign Service Institute categorizes Czech as a level IV language, which means a very hard language that takes 44 weeks or 1,100 hours to learn at a basic conversational level.
